The Evolution of Refrigerators
Fridges have come a long method because their creation. Here is a timeline highlighting the key turning points in fridge freezer technology:
YearMilestone1755Scottish scientist William Cullen shows the principle of refrigeration.1834Jacob Perkins builds the very first practical fridge freezers for sale uk, using ether as a refrigerant.1913The very first commercially successful refrigerator, the “Domelre,” is produced in the U.S.1927General Electric presents the first buy fridge freezers for home usage.1930sFridges end up being a common household product, featuring necessary storage compartments.1970sEnergy-efficient models are developed as ecological concerns increase.2000sSmart refrigerators enter into play, featuring touch screens, internet connectivity, and advanced food management systems.Types of Refrigerators
With developments in innovation and customer choices, different kinds of refrigerators have emerged. The following table sums up the various types available today:
TypeDescriptionSuitable ForTop FreezerTraditional style with the freezer compartment situated above the fridge.Budget-conscious familiesBottom FreezerFreezer drawer located listed below the fridge, offering simpler access to fresh food.Consumers focusing on fresh products.Side-by-SideFreezer and fridge compartments are nearby, offering easy gain access to.Big households needing company.French Door2 side-by-side doors for the fridge and a bottom drawer for the freezer.Those who prepare often and require room.Compact (Mini)Smaller units developed for tight areas, like dorms or workplaces.Students or small families.Smart RefrigeratorGeared up with Wi-Fi connectivity and wise innovation for enhanced functionality.Tech-savvy users.Secret Features to Consider
When purchasing a refrigerator, several features ought to be thought about based on individual needs and kitchen area. Here’s a list of necessary features:
Energy Efficiency: Look for models with the Energy Star label to ensure reduced energy intake.Size and Capacity: Consider the dimensions and storage space based on your family size and kitchen design.Temperature Control: Adjustable temperature level settings and specialized compartments assist maintain food freshness.Water and Ice Dispenser: This hassle-free function is outstanding for households who utilize ice regularly or enjoy cooled water.Additional Storage Solutions: Features such as adjustable racks, door bins, and humidity-controlled drawers can enhance performance.Smart Technology: Models with Wi-Fi connection can offer functions like stock tracking, grocery list management, and temperature tracking through mobile phone apps.Sound Level: Some models operate quieter than others, an important consider open-concept home.Maintenance and Care Tips
To make sure the longevity and optimal efficiency of your refrigerator, routine upkeep is important. Here are some maintenance ideas:
Clean Coils: Dust and debris can accumulate on the coils, impeding performance. Tidy them every 6 months using a vacuum or a brush.Examine Door Seals: Ensure that the door seals are airtight to keep the temperature constant. Check them by closing the door on a paper; if you can pull it out quickly, the seal may need replacement.Routine Defrosting: If you have a manual defrost model, defrost it frequently to keep performance.Tidy Interior: Wipe down racks and bins frequently with a mild cleaner to avoid odors and bacteria buildup.Display Temperature: Keep the fridge temperature between 35 ° F and 38 ° F( 1.6 ° C and 3.3 ° C )for optimal food preservation.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. How long can food last in the fridge?
Food durability varies depending upon the type. For example, raw poultry can last 1-2 days, while tough cheeses can last approximately 6 months. Constantly refer to standards for particular food items.
2. What is the ideal temperature for a fridge?
The perfect temperature is in between 35 ° F and 38 ° F (1.6 ° C and 3.3 ° C) to make sure food security and freshness.
3. Can I keep hot food in the fridge?
It is suggested to let hot food cool to room temperature before positioning it in the cheap fridge uk to prevent raising the internal temperature, which might affect other food items.
4. How typically should I clean my fridge?
Routine cleansing is suggested every few months, with interior cleaning being vital to prevent smells and bacteria.

6. Do fridges utilize a great deal of electrical energy?
Energy usage differs by model, but modern-day energy-efficient designs are developed to use less electrical power. The Energy Star ranking can help identify the most efficient choices.
